Sol C. Siegel

First Name Sol
Last Name Siegel
Born on March 30, 1903
Died on December 29, 1982 (aged 79)

Sol C. Siegel was an American film producer. Two of the numerous films he produced, A Letter to Three Wives (1949) and Three Coins in the Fountain (1954), were nominated for the Academy Award for Best Picture.

Jiwansingh Sheombar

First Name Jiwansingh
Born on April 15, 1957
Died on December 8, 1982 (aged 25)

The December murders were the murders on 7, 8, and 9 December 1982, of fifteen prominent young Surinamese men who had criticized the military dictatorship then ruling Suriname. Thirteen of these men were arrested on December 7 between 2 am and 5 am while sleeping in their homes. The other two were Surendre Rambocus and Jiwansingh Sheombar who were already imprisoned for attempting a counter-coup in March 1982. Soldiers of Dési Bouterse, the then dictator of Suriname, took them to Fort Zeelandia, where they were heard as 'suspects in a trial' by Bouterse and other sergeants in a self-appointed court. After these 'hearings' they were tortured and shot dead. The circumstances have not yet become completely clear; on December 10, 1982, Bouterse claimed on national television that all of the detainees had been shot dead 'in an attempt to flee'.

Ralph Teetor

First Name Ralph
Last Name Teetor
Born on August 17, 1890
Died on February 15, 1982 (aged 91)

Ralph Teetor was a prolific inventor who invented cruise control. He was the longtime president of the automotive parts manufacturer The Perfect Circle Co. in Hagerstown, Indiana, a manufacturer of piston rings.
